Gemini Sun

The driving force behind the Gemini zodiac sign is conversation. They are generally charming and charismatic, and they always have stories to tell. Often quite adept at fitting in with others, Geminis easily adopt the moods of those around them. They are friends to people from all walks of life, and are not easily intimidated. This is a sign of adaptability, flexibility, and change.

Gemini is the sign of the Twins, and this duality is an important feature of the Gemini temperament. Knowing that change is inevitable, people born in this sign can be constantly aware of opposing points of view, divergent opinions, and the various options in any situation. But this also means they can go with the flow and are quite adaptable to changes in life.They may feel more comfortable seeing themselves in a constant state of flux. They can shift or change as the moment does, depending on their mood. And the Sun in Gemini means they go along with these changes with a positive attitude and an optimistic outlook of the world. Being with someone like that can be very inspiring.

These people like to have options, and need to feel the freedom to be able to choose. This then leads to the tendency to create numerous options for themselves, which can mean becoming scattered. Too many choices can lead to overwhelm, and sometimes they will find that less equals more.

These natives are often just as interested in collecting information as they are in sharing it.

Famous people with Sun in Gemini:
John F. Kennedy - His Sun is in the 8th house. It is at 7°50’ of Gemini. It rules the 11th house.
Marilyn Monroe - Her Sun is in the 10th house. It is at 10°26’ of Gemini. It rules the 1st house.
Bob Dylan - His Sun is in the 6th house. It is at 3°30’ of Gemini. It doesn't rule any of the houses.
Nicole Kidman - Her Sun is in the 8th house. It is at 29°00’ of Gemini. It rules the 10th house.





Gemini Sun in the First House

Individuals with a Gemini Sun in the First House radiate an infectious energy that captivates those around them. Their dual nature manifests in an adaptability that allows them to navigate different social situations with ease, making them the life of any gathering. This placement amplifies their curiosity, often leading them on intellectual quests and spontaneous adventures. The charm of Gemini enhances their persona, encouraging others to draw closer and engage in stimulating conversation.

Moreover, this positioning emphasizes self-expression as a crucial aspect of their identity. With the ability to articulate thoughts fluidly, those born under this sign may find themselves drawn to creative fields such as writing, journalism, or public speaking. They thrive when they can share ideas and connect with others on a mental level but need to be wary of superficial connections; deepening relationships will enrich their experience considerably. Ultimately, Gemini Suns in the First House embody the spirit of constant change and exploration, forever seeking new horizons while leaving a lasting impression wherever they go.

Gemini Sun in the Sixth House

Gemini Sun in the Sixth House creates a unique interplay between intellect and daily routines, where vibrant curiosity fuels work and health matters. Individuals with this placement often find themselves in careers that embrace communication or require adaptability, such as writing, teaching, or healthcare. Their innate ability to juggle multiple tasks can be a blessing in environments that demand quick thinking and versatility; however, it can also lead to scattered energies if not managed well.

Additionally, this placement nurtures an inquisitive approach to wellness. Those with a Gemini Sun here may experiment with various diets or fitness regimens—constantly seeking what makes them feel alive and engaged. They thrive on variety rather than strict routines, often engaging in diverse activities that stimulate both mind and body. Ultimately, embracing this duality empowers them to establish dynamic systems that cater to their health while satisfying their ever-present craving for change.

With an eye on collaboration, Gemini Suns in the Sixth House excel when working alongside others who inspire them intellectually. Interpersonal connections are vital; these individuals are motivated by lively exchanges at work that spark new ideas while balancing practical efforts for success. By fostering an environment where innovation meets responsibility, they carve out workflows that resonate deeply with their curious spirit yet maintain the structure needed to thrive professionally.
